Script error: No such module "Nihongo". is a 1956 Japanese horror film directed by Bin Kado and produced by Daiei Film. It was filmed in black-and-white in the Academy ratio format.[1]

Plot

Set along the historic Tōkaidō road, the narrative follows a power struggle in the fief of Okazaki, leading to the death of Namiji, a nobleman's daughter. Her fiancé seeks revenge, aided by Namiji's cat, which plays a pivotal role in confronting the perpetrators.

Production

Filming commenced in February 1956 and concluded in June of the same year.

Availability

The film has been made available on DVD with English subtitles.[5]
